As part of the revision of the environmental regulations in the bodyshop sector implemented in January, the EPA has announced the procedure for applications to become part of a  National Panel of Approved Assessors.


The Solvent and Decorative Paint Regulations of 2012, specify that the Environmental Protection Agency must appoint a National Panel of Approved Assessors before 30th September, 2013. This process has now been commenced with the EPA inviting interested parties with appropriate education, skills and resources, to submit an application and relevant documentation, by way of open-competition, for appointment to the National Panel.  The information submitted will then be assessed by a panel of evaluators, using the criteria specified in the “Notice of Appointment”.

Based on the outcome of this process, the Board of the Agency will then appoint one to three bodies to the National Panel of Approved Assessors.

The “Notice of Appointment” specifies the services to be carried out and the details that must be included within the submissions.

Queries regarding this notice and the application process should be submitted by e-mail to; solvents@epa.ie. The closing date for receipt of queries is Tuesday 21 May 2013.

All applicant documentation must be submitted to the EPA by post prior to the deadline of Thursday 30 May 2013 at 4pm.

Application documentation can be downloaded from the EPA website.

This an important stage in the revision of the regulations as it should bring added competition into the sector which will hopefully be to the benefit of bodyshops.
